Family First Parent Resiliency Group at Sierra Del Oro. Promoting parenting resiliency using Dialectical Behavioral Therapy (DBT) principles and skills training. This free group is intended for: parents of children 0-5 years old who have experienced stressful or traumatic events that may have an impact on the parent-child relationship. While parents engage together, our trained staff will provide social-emotional learning (SEL) programming to children 2-5 years old ( younger and older siblings are also welcome). Bring the whole family.
